Output dd63dce3a962ae800521e9f532547110dc9d820fb74bab3c51ce983789407053:0

value
89620092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1247c30c8a9cb19c7d412d91299c965448050963 OP_EQUAL
address
33Mg46r8criD7tEQM148rAiTsan8yvBBjP
transaction
dd63dce3a962ae800521e9f532547110dc9d820fb74bab3c51ce983789407053
spent
true